Actually, it isn't like the endorsements pro athletes receive. Air time for a show on the Outdoor Channel is over 100k for a season. That is 13 shows. The folks that want to have their own shows have to find sponsors to cover that cost, the cost of their hunts, and hope to have a little left over to live on. There are only a very few ( Lee and Tiff, Jay Gregory, the Drurys, etc) that actually make a decent coin doing the television shows. The vast majority do not make enough to make it worthwhile for a sane person to pursue. A great many of the commercials you see during any given show are owned by Outdoor Channel and do not benefit the producers of the show...this is why you will see muzzy commercials mixed in during a show that is sponsored by Rage...you get the point. Additionally, most of the folks doing shows are very poor at promoting their sponsor's product in a tactful way...and that is why most of them do not do well financially. If they don't do a good job of selling the product, they have to find new sponsors each season and first season sponsor are not willing to invest heavily for what is likely going to be weak promotion at best.
